lib/redis_graph/edge.ex

defmodule RedisGraph.Edge do
@moduledoc """
An Edge component relating two Nodes in a Graph.
Edges must have a source node and destination node, describing a relationship
between two entities in a Graph. The nodes must exist in the Graph in order
for the edge to be added.
Edges must have a relation which identifies the type of relationship being
described between entities
Edges, like Nodes, may also have properties, a map of values which describe
attributes of the relationship between the associated Nodes.
"""
alias RedisGraph.Util
@type t() :: %__MODULE__{
id: integer(),
src_node: Node.t() | number(),
dest_node: Node.t() | number(),
relation: String.t(),
properties: %{optional(String.t()) => any()}
}
@enforce_keys [:src_node, :dest_node, :relation]
defstruct [:id, :src_node, :dest_node, :relation, properties: %{}]
@doc """
Create a new Edge from a map.
## Example
edge = Edge.new(%{
src_node: john,
dest_node: japan,
relation: "visited"
})
"""
@spec new(map()) :: t()
def new(map) do
struct(__MODULE__, map)
end
@doc "Convert an edge's properties to a query-appropriate string."
@spec properties_to_string(t()) :: String.t()
def properties_to_string(edge) do
inner =
Map.keys(edge.properties)
|> Enum.map(fn key -> "#{key}:#{Util.quote_string(edge.properties[key])}" end)
|> Enum.join(",")
if String.length(inner) > 0 do
"{" <> inner <> "}"
else
""
end
end
@doc "Convert an edge to a query-appropriate string."
@spec to_query_string(t()) :: String.t()
def to_query_string(edge) do
src_node_string = "(" <> edge.src_node.alias <> ")"
edge_string =
case edge.relation do
"" -> "-[" <> properties_to_string(edge) <> "]->"
nil -> "-[" <> properties_to_string(edge) <> "]->"
other -> "-[:" <> other <> properties_to_string(edge) <> "]->"
end
dest_node_string = "(" <> edge.dest_node.alias <> ")"
src_node_string <> edge_string <> dest_node_string
end
@doc """
Compare two edges with respect to equality.
Comparison logic:
* If the ids differ, returns ``false``
* If the source nodes differ, returns ``false``
* If the destination nodes differ, returns ``false``
* If the relations differ, returns ``false``
* If the properties differ, returns ``false``
* Otherwise returns `true`
"""
@spec compare(t(), t()) :: boolean()
def compare(left, right) do
cond do
left.id != right.id -> false
left.src_node != right.src_node -> false
left.dest_node != right.dest_node -> false
left.relation != right.relation -> false
map_size(left.properties) != map_size(right.properties) -> false
not Map.equal?(left.properties, right.properties) -> false
true -> true
end
end
end
